Excel und seine Formeln

Hallo zusammen!

Die Monate haben unterschiedlich lange Tage. Von Monat zu Monat, von Jahr zu Schaltjahr und so weiter…

Nun habe ich eine Tabelle mit den Tagen 1 bis 31.

Ich möchte dass die Tage die im gerade aktuellen Monat nicht vorkommen z.Bsp. schwarz unterlegt sind.

In Libre Calc erreiche ich das Problemlos indem ich mit der Formel „tageimmonat(heute())“ und einer bedingten Formatierung arbeite.

Nun möchte ich das auch noch in Excel übertragen. Aber da finde ich einfach keine Vergleichbare Lösung! Und ich probiere schon seit Stunden rum!

Wer weiss Rat?Screenshot 2025-04-15 051708

Stimmt. Januar-Tage sind wesentlich kürzer als Juli-Tage.
Falls Du meinst: „Die Monate haben eine unterschiedliche Anzahl von Tagen“, dann schreib das auch so hin.

Manche Tage kommen nie vor, egal ob aktueller Monat oder nicht.

Ich habe keine Ahnung, wozu Deine Tabelle gut sein soll, aber ich habe laufende Tabellen, die über mehrere Jahre gehen und bin froh, daß Excel beim „Datum-Runterziehen“ so einen Mist nicht macht und von selbst „weiß“, welcher Monat wieviele Tage hat und wann ein Schaltjahr ist.

Moin,

wie wär’s denn damit, nur die Tage des aktuellen Monats anzuzeigen?

Gruß
Ralf

1 Like

Ich habe gerade 5 Minuten rumprobiert. Nimm anstatt
tageimmonat(heute())
einfach
TAG(MONATSENDE(HEUTE();0))

2 Like

Die Lösung von Julius war absolut korrekt.

Dein Beitrag ist nicht hilfreich. Eine Lösung bietest Du nicht an, was aber in diesem Forum erwartet wird. Stattdessen kritisierst Du lediglich meine Fragestellung. Aber offenbar bist Du intelligent genug um meine Frage richtig zu interpretieren. Ansonsten wurde die Fragestellung ja durch die Pic’s untermalt. Bitte lass doch Beiträge sein, die nicht zur Lösung beitragen können. Trotzdem danke dafür dass Du die Frage so genau (wenn auch sachfremd) gelesen hast. Dein Beitrag hat nun doch noch einen Nutzen: Ich werde in Zukunft versuchen meine Fragen korrekt zu stellen.

1 Like

Vielen Dank Rolf für Deine Gegenfrage. Aber dafür hätte ich selbst die Lösung parat gehabt.
Es gibt einen bestimmten Grund dafür wieso ich das so haben muss.